Hybrid Optimization Assisted Transmit Antenna Selection for Massive MIMO Technology.

Charanjeet Singh, P.C. Kishore Raja

Multimedia tools and applications(2023)

摘要
MIMO (Multi-input, Multi-output) systems are a key technology for achieving 5G wireless communications’ performance goals. They achieve significant levels of various acquisition, consistency, and efficiency. Nonetheless, for more transmit antennas; more radio frequency (RF) chains are necessary, which may result in increased computational complexity and expenses. As a result, selecting the optimal transmit antennas is critical for improving system performance. This paper offers a new Fitness-based Elephant Herding Algorithm (F-EHA) for selecting the optimal broadcast antenna by specifying many criteria such as secrecy rate and efficiency. In addition, the system provides a recommendation for which antenna to use. Finally, the suggested model’s advantage over existing techniques in terms of EE (Energy Efficiency) and secrecy rate is demonstrated.
